Weslaco man, 29, charged with murder for 78-year-old man’s beating death

The Hidalgo County Sheriff’s Office plans to upgrade charges against a 29-year-old Weslaco man for the fatal beating of a 78-year-old man during a “landlord-tenant dispute.”

In a news release, the sheriff’s office said Vidal Cruz died Friday following injuries he sustained on March 18 at the hands of Cristian Puentes.

The move comes following an autopsy, which found Cruz’s cause of death was blunt force trauma to the head and his manner of death as homicide, according to a news release.

The alleged beating happened at 12:42 p.m. that day in the 2900 block of Hermosillo Street in Weslaco.

When deputies arrived, Cruz told them he had been assaulted by Puentes over the dispute, according to the release.

“Deputies observed visible facial injuries on Mr. Cruz from the alleged assault,” the release stated. “He expressed feelings of faintness and was transported to a local hospital for treatment.”

Witnesses told investigators they saw a man in a yellow shirt kicking Cruz in the head and surveillance confirmed Puentes wore a yellow shirt on the day of the assault, according to the release.

Deputies arrested Puentes on March 19 on unrelated warrants.

He remains held in the Hidalgo County Adult Detention Center on a $500,000 bond on a charge of injury to an elderly person. On Tuesday afternoon, he is scheduled for a bond hearing when the charge is upgraded to murder.
